Patti Smith's annual Bowery New Years shows - tix on sale
Photo by Jean Baptiste Mondino

Patti Smith & her band play Bowery Ballroom on December 30 and 31, 2008. Tickets are currently on American Express presale and switch to regular sale on Friday.
